Dr. Wakefield's 1998 article in The Lancet, which suggested a link between the measles, mumps, and rubella (MMR) vaccine and autism, has been a topic of intense debate and controversy in the medical community. Despite being retracted by The Lancet in 2010 due to serious concerns about the validity of the data and the ethical conduct of the research, the article has had a lasting impact on public perception of vaccines. Wakefield's claims have been widely discredited by numerous studies and reviews, yet the myth of a link between vaccines and autism persists. This has led to a decline in vaccination rates and an increase in preventable diseases. The motivations behind Wakefield's article and the subsequent fallout have been the subject of much speculation and criticism, with some suggesting that he was influenced by personal biases or financial interests.

Impact of the article: Discussing how the article may have influenced public opinion and vaccination rates

The publication of the anti-vaccine article by a medical professional had far-reaching consequences on public health and opinion. One of the most significant impacts was the erosion of trust in the medical community and scientific institutions. Parents who were already skeptical about vaccines found validation in the doctor's claims, leading to a decrease in vaccination rates among certain demographics. This decline in immunization had a ripple effect, contributing to the resurgence of preventable diseases such as measles and whooping cough.

Furthermore, the article fueled the anti-vaccine movement, emboldening activists to spread misinformation and conspiracy theories about the dangers of vaccines. Social media platforms became breeding grounds for this misinformation, allowing it to spread rapidly and reach a wide audience. As a result, many individuals who were previously pro-vaccine began to question the safety and efficacy of immunizations, leading to a polarization of public opinion on the issue.
